Wilson's Promontory 'Naturally'
Wilson's Promontory National Park was established in 1898, the area itself renowned for the tranquility and untouched beauty over such an expanse. Many islands also make up 'The Prom' and you will find these a highlight of your day.
The depth of the water around these islands allows our vessel to cruise in very close, viewing remote beaches, huge seal colonies and spectacular rock caves that you could fit a house in! You will be able to tell your friends that you have seen the most Southern tip of mainland Australia, an experience that few can claim!
Enjoy a delicious Buffet Lunch on board the cruiser, surrounded by amazing coastlines and feeling totally relaxed and detached from your every day life. Witness the beauty of the Wilson's Prom lighthouse, a sight only otherwise visible by way of a 19km walk!
Cruise into a magical little cove, sheltered from winds, with crystal clear water, where the bush meets the white sands...'Refuge Cove' is a popular anchorage for passing yachts and fishing vessels. Here you will spend a couple of hours, with the choice of a snorkel (BYO), swim, short bush walk, sunbake or whatever you can cope with! After this chance to feel the land you will be treated to a further cruise along the sandy coastlines, viewing the beautiful Sights of the Prom on sunset.
